This is a list of the 1987 PGA Tour Qualifying School graduates. 54 players earned their 1988

card through Q-School in 1987. The tournament was played over 108 holes at Pine Lakes Golf Club and Matanzas Golf Club, in

. Those earning cards split the $100,000 purse, with the winner earning $15,000.

Tournament summary

Several former PGA Tour winners entered the tournament trying to regain full-time status. They included

, John Fought, Barry Jaeckel, Bobby Cole, and Leonard Thompson. Eichelberger and Thompson were the only ones that were successful. Fought was disqualified in the first round for signing an incorrect scorecard.
